What is a function?

Back

A function is a relation between a set of inputs and a set of possible outputs where each input is related to exactly one output.

What does it mean to evaluate a function?

Back

To evaluate a function means to calculate the output of the function for a specific input value.

What is the notation for a function?

Back

Functions are typically denoted by letters such as f, g, or h, followed by the input in parentheses, e.g., f(x).

How do you find f(2) if f(x) = 2x^2 + 3?

Back

Substitute 2 into the function: f(2) = 2(2)^2 + 3 = 8 + 3 = 11.

Evaluate f(x) = 2x^2 + 5x - 17 for f(-1).

Back

f(-1) = 2(-1)^2 + 5(-1) - 17 = 2 - 5 - 17 = -20.

What is the output of f(5) if f(x) = 3x + 1?

Back

f(5) = 3(5) + 1 = 15 + 1 = 16.

Evaluate h(x) = -x^2 + 3x for h(5).

Back

h(5) = -(5)^2 + 3(5) = -25 + 15 = -10.
